Types of Childcare

There are lots of kinds of child care offered near me, including daycare facilities, home-based treatment, and preschool programs. Daycare centers are generally big facilities that can accommodate a large number of young ones, while home-based treatment providers run from their own homes. Preschool programs are designed to prepare kiddies for preschool and past, with a focus on very early education and socialization.

Each kind of child care has its own benefits and drawbacks. Daycare centers offer an organized environment with skilled staff and educational tasks, nonetheless they could be costly and may also have long waiting lists. Home-based treatment providers offer a far more individualized and versatile strategy, but may not have exactly the same degree of oversight as daycare facilities. Preschool programs offer a very good academic foundation for children, but is almost certainly not appropriate all households considering price or area.

Advantages of Child Care

Childcare offers numerous benefits for kids and families. Studies have shown that kiddies whom attend high-quality child care programs are more likely to become successful academically and socially later in life. Child care also provides moms and dads with satisfaction, comprehending that kids come in a safe and nurturing environment as they have reached work.

Besides, childcare can really help kids develop essential social and psychological skills, eg empathy, collaboration, and dispute quality. Kids whom attend child care programs have the chance to connect to peers from diverse backgrounds, helping all of them develop a sense of tolerance and acceptance.

Challenges of Child Care

Despite its benefits, childcare additionally provides difficulties for families. Also, finding top-quality child care near me may be hard, particularly in places with limited options.

Another challenge may be the prospect of return among childcare providers, which could disrupt the security and continuity of take care of young ones. Also, some people could have concerns about the top-notch care supplied in some childcare configurations, leading to anxiety and doubt about the youngster's well being.
